Business Context and Reporting Period
This Form 8-K Current Report was filed by Revolution Medicines, Inc. on June 18, 2025. The report discloses a corporate governance event involving the resignation of a director effective immediately prior to the Company's 2025 annual meeting of stockholders scheduled for June 26, 2025.

Material Changes
The material change reported is the resignation of Barbara Weber, M.D., from the Board of Directors. Dr. Weber also resigned from her roles on the Nominating and Corporate Governance Committee and the Research & Development Committee. The filing states this departure was not the result of any disagreement with the Company regarding operations, policies, or practices.
Outlook, Risks, and Management Commentary
Management commentary indicates that Dr. Weber's resignation is in connection with the activation of a clinical study under an ongoing collaboration between Revolution Medicines and Tango Therapeutics, Inc. No specific financial guidance, new risks, or unusual items were disclosed in this filing.
